Responsibilities

Technical expert, leading in the design of new/existing products and projects. Evaluates and optimizes solutions on products, parts, or processes for cost efficiency and reliability. Works with other members of the engineering staff to ensure that projects/products are is completed in a timely manner. Relies on extensive experience and judgment to plan and accomplish goals. Performs a variety of tasks.

Qualifications

  • Must have Electrical Engineering and/or Computer Engineering Degree
  • 8+ years of experience in FPGA design
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ving and multi-tasking skills
  • Advanced and diversified knowledge of engineering principles
  • Strong FPGA skills and experience
  • Working knowledge of analog & digital electronics, sensors and signal processing
  • Familiarity with instrumentation & controls as used in an oilfield environment, onshore and offshore
  • Willingness to target minimum viable product to align with program objectives
